## Authentication

Heads up: the nightly reindex job (`reindex_nightly.py`) talks to the Lanternfish search cluster, and that cluster won't accept anonymous writes anymore — we locked it down last sprint. The job now authenticates as the `reindex-runner` service identity against Corvid Gateway, and the token is injected via the `LF_INDEX_TOKEN` env var in the scheduler config. Nothing clever going on, just a bearer header on every batch request. For review purposes, the staging credential currently in use is listed below.

service key, kadug-kadup: kto15_rN23XLAYImmZgrJ

## Deploying the Gatewick Proctor Queue

Deploys are pretty painless: push to main, wait for the pipeline, then watch the queue drain dashboard for five minutes. If candidates pile up mid-exam, roll back first and ask questions later — the queue replays safely. Everything the workers care about lives in one config block, shown here for reference.

settings of bafof-yagef:
JOROX_PIN=8740
JOROX_TENANT=pelox
JOROX_METRICS_HOST=metrics.jorox.qorvelworks.internal
JOROX_SEAL=seal_c78f63c1
JOROX_STANDBY_TEAM=norax

Subject: Bulk-edit cut-over done

Hi Marisol,

Quick wrap-up: the new bulk-edit flow in the Ferrowisp admin table went live this morning. Old row-by-row editing is disabled, batch size caps are enforced server-side, and undo works for up to ten minutes. No incidents so far. For the release notes, here's the production configuration we ended up shipping with.

deployment values, yafop-tahof:
HOLIX_HOST=holix.zemvarsys.internal
HOLIX_PORT=3306

## Formula sandbox tuning

User-supplied formulas in Gridmoor execute inside a restricted interpreter with hard ceilings on time, memory, and call depth. Reviewers should confirm any change to these ceilings is justified in the PR description, since raising them widens the abuse surface. Defaults were chosen from production traces. The current limits are as follows.

limits module of tafog-fawip:
WEIGHTS = {
    "julix": 57,
    "lamys": 992,
    "kasvan": 209,
    "quenok": 750,
    "alddor": 259,
    "oliath": 1009,
    "wenix": 815,
}